Window Well Service in Denver County, CO

Window well services focus on installing, repairing, and maintaining protective enclosures around basement windows. These services help property owners ensure that window wells are properly installed to prevent water intrusion, provide safe egress in case of emergencies, and enhance the overall appearance of the property. Projects typically include installing new window wells, replacing damaged or rusted covers, and addressing issues like improper drainage or corrosion. Homeowners often seek these services when upgrading basement windows, addressing water leaks, or ensuring compliance with safety codes for emergency exits.

Before requesting window well services, property owners should consider the condition of existing window wells and whether they require reinforcement or replacement. It is helpful to understand the size and type of window wells needed for specific basement windows and whether additional features like covers or drainage systems are desired. Clarifying the goals for safety, water management, and aesthetic improvement can assist in selecting the appropriate solutions. Proper assessment and planning ensure that the window wells serve their intended purpose effectively and complement the property's overall maintenance.

Project Types

Common Window Well Service Jobs

Window well installation - prevents water from entering basement windows during heavy rain.

Window well repair - restores structural integrity and prevents leaks around basement windows.

Drainage solutions - directs water away from window wells to avoid flooding and water damage.

Cover installation - adds protection against debris, snow, and pests entering basement windows.

Leak sealing - stops water from seeping through window wells into basement spaces.

Window well replacement - upgrades old or damaged wells to improve safety and function.

FAQ

Window Well Service Questions

What is a window well? A window well is a structure installed around basement windows to prevent soil from blocking light and to provide safe access during emergencies.

Why is proper drainage important for window wells? Proper drainage helps prevent water accumulation, which can lead to leaks, flooding, and damage to the basement area.

What materials are used for window well covers? Window well covers are typically made from durable materials like polycarbonate or metal to protect against debris and weather.

When should a window well be repaired or replaced? Repairs or replacements are needed if there are signs of rust, cracks, water pooling, or structural instability around the window well.
